Well Michael, I see a difference then, and I think that itself justify the cost, this pen has 2 sides, one is the Color Base, and the other is the Clear Coat and Pearl in my case, that for the most matching process possible, also the applicator pen is a lot better than those old style brushes, I can tell you by experience now that I've used both of them.

Jewls wrote:Just a question, why would you buy touch up paint from ebay and pay shipping when the dealer sells it for $5 per bottle? I just picked mine up while I was there. :-?


The dealer was out of when I was there Monday and they wanted $11.95 for the paint & clear coat pen when they got it in. The pen system is much easier to use and looks much better than the brush system.
